• Volvo enjoyed a 27% rise in truck sales during the first quarter of 1989 — up from £438m to 2556m. The company says that its order backlog for trucks remains "very strong". In the first quarter it delivered 14,300 trucks, compared with 12,700 in 1988.

There was a 4% rise in Volvo bus sales — up from £75.6m to .278.7m -and the company says that order books were fuller now than in 1988.

Overall Volvo's firstquarter operating profit was up 30% to £186.3m. o Volvo has signed a cooperation agreement with South Korean company Daewoo for the import of Volvo trucks into the booming South Korean market. The deal also includes a plan to manufacture Volvo trucks in South Korea where 8,000 heavy trucks were sold last year.
